Circa 1963. Painting on silk pasted on cardboard. Signed Lepho lower right in ink. Titled and stamped Galerie Romanet on the reverse. 54 x 33 cm. Provenance: Galerie Romanet, Paris. A certificate of authenticity issued by Mr Alain Le Kim, son and successor in title of Le Pho, dated 9 July 2024, will be at the buyer's expense (€650) and will be given to the buyer. This work will appear in the catalogue raisonné being prepared by Mr Alain Le Kim. His work can be divided into three main periods, correlating with distinct styles in a political climate and historical context that changed according to the period. The first period, around 1920-45, refers to the artist's youthful works, in which his already identifiable style remains classical and Asian in its treatment of subjects and technique. The second period, known as the Romanet period (1945-62), reflects the gallery owner who exhibited Le Phô's work for many years. Finally, the third period, known as the "Findlay period" (1963-2001), refers to the Wally Findlay gallery in the United States, which exhibited the artist's work from this period until his death.
